Machine Operator (4 on 4 off - Days & Nights)

Site based role based commutable from Telford, Shrewsbury, Wolverhampton, Bridgnorth, Market Drayton, Newport, Whitchurch, Ironbridge, Broseley,

£35,300 + 4 of 4 off shift + Weekly pay+ Overtime (1.5x) Structured Training + Pension + Health Cash Plan + Life Assurance + Avg Holiday Pay + Tech Schemes + 4 Weeks Holiday + Bank Holidays

Are you a driven and ambitious Machine Operator based in or around Telford looking to join a market-leading manufacturer offering structured training, clear progression routes, and the opportunity to work with world-class, fully automated production machinery?

This is a fantastic opportunity to join a global business at the forefront of engineering and automation, operating state-of-the-art manufacturing systems from their modern Telford facility, recognised for delivering high-quality, precision-engineered products to major industries.

They are known for investing heavily in their people, technology, and processes-providing full technical training, defined career pathways, and opportunities to advance your career within a business that values determination, quality, integrity, and teamwork.

The company promotes long-term growth and continuous improvement, offering a modern production environment, hands-on technical experience, and a clear roadmap to progress to Level 2 (£39,452) and Level 3 (£43,489) within just nine months.

This position would suit someone with a practical, hands-on mindset who enjoys working with machinery, problem solving, and maintaining high production standards.

It's an excellent opportunity for a Machine Operator in Telford looking to build a rewarding, long-term career with ongoing training .


The Role:

* Working as part of a production team on state-of-the-art automated machinery
* Performing line changeovers, fault finding, and hands-on problem solving to maintain output
* 4 on 4 off rotating shift pattern - covering both days and nights

The Person:

* Experience working within a production, FMCG, or processing environment
* Strong mechanical or technical aptitude with hands-on problem-solving ability
* A driven individual looking for structured training and long-term career progression
